As the title state, what swing weights have yall seen with the stock M4? I know the head is lighter than most at around 190-195 grams compared to 200-205 or what not.

 

I haven't gotten the SW of mine yet, but will soon. It seems extremely light, therefore I was going to add some lead tape but I haven't decided where. Where have yall?

 

To add - I am playing a HZRDUS Yellow and it is cut down to 44.5

I have an off-the-rack M4 with the "R" flex Atmos shaft. By my scale I get just a hair over D3 swingweight.

 

That's with the original stock grip installed. I'm guessing it would drop slightly with a normal-weight grip. The one that comes on there is like 47g instead of the usual 51-52g.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

The Tour Velvet will probably add about 4g or so to the overall weight and reduce the swingweight by one point or a bit less, compared to the factory standard grip.

 

The M4 is overall going to be light no matter what the swingweight works out to. As you said, the head itself is very light.

 

Most of my drivers with mid-50's weight shafts and normal grips tend to be 310-315g overall weight. Can't remember exactly but my M4 is more like 302g or 304g, something like that. Not quite what I'd call ultralight but it's light.

 

If I didn't hit the thing so straight and so far I'd swap out the weight plug in the head and try to get up over 310g...but for now i don't want to mess with a good thing!

I just got a custom order made from TM after a recent fitting tent session locally. I went with the 12* M4 turned down to 10.5* so it sits 3* open with the Atmos Red 5S minus 1" for playing length of 44.75" with a standard GP Tour Wrap Blk (50gram grip). Of course, I knew it would come in lighter than the D3 that I wanted (my estimates were C8-9). It was exactly C9 minus this one inch. So I ordered the Billy Bobs 10gram replacement weight which comes with the torx tool bit to change the stock weight out and add the new 10gram weight. After the install which took 3.5 seconds, back on the swing scale it was and she sat at a perfect D3 with the BB 10gram weight at 44.75". No lead tape, clean, and a little blue lock tight and tighten and not too much tension on the screw down to avoid stripping and I am done! Check this out if you don't want lead tape.

If you are thinking of getting a grip that doesn’t suit you in order to trick the swingweight scale into reading one point different then don’t do it. Totally awful idea. The fact that “swingweight” measurement is affected by grip weight is a flaw in the way it is measured.

 

A one point change in SW due to a heavier/lighter grip does not feel anything like a one point change in SW due to clubhead or shaft weight. The swingweight scale is designed to quantify “feel” of a club but it assumes a standard 50-ish gram grip weight.
